Surrogacy Agencies: Comprehensive Guidance and Support
Surrogacy agencies play a pivotal role in providing comprehensive guidance and support to surrogates. This section explores the services offered by surrogacy agencies in Mexico, including matching surrogates with intended parents, coordinating medical appointments, facilitating legal processes, and providing ongoing emotional support. It emphasizes the importance of working with reputable agencies that prioritize the well-being of surrogates.
Medical Professionals: Ensuring Surrogates' Physical and Emotional Health
Medical professionals, including fertility specialists and obstetricians, play a critical role in ensuring the physical and emotional health of surrogates throughout the surrogacy process. This section discusses the medical support available to surrogates, including comprehensive medical examinations, prenatal care, and counseling services. It emphasizes the collaborative approach between medical professionals and surrogates to address any concerns or challenges that may arise.
Legal Support: Protecting Surrogates' Rights and Interests
Surrogacy involves complex legal considerations, and surrogates require legal support to protect their rights and interests. This section explores the legal resources available to surrogates in Mexico, such as legal representation and guidance on contractual agreements, parental rights, and the legal aspects of the surrogacy process. It emphasizes the importance of surrogates understanding their legal rights and having access to legal professionals who can advocate on their behalf.
Surrogate Support Groups and Communities: Building a Network of Peers
Surrogate support groups and communities offer surrogates the opportunity to connect with others who have shared experiences. This section explores the benefits of surrogate support groups, including the exchange of information, emotional support, and the sense of belonging that comes from connecting with peers who understand the unique journey of surrogacy. It highlights the importance of fostering a supportive community where surrogates can share their challenges, triumphs, and concerns.
